From a physical point of view, the ability to heat insulation and support combustion is the primary factor of wood-plastic flooring. The wood-plastic flooring invented in modern times can resist high temperatures as well as low temperatures. Secondly, high hardness is also very important. If the hardness is too low, it will increase unnecessary consumption. With the guarantee of hardness, no cracking and wear resistance also need to be reflected. The most important feature of plastic wood flooring is environmental protection, so from the perspective of environmental protection, it does not contain toxic substances and will not cause air or environmental pollution.


Since it is a wood-plastic floor as furniture, it must not lag behind in appearance. It has the appearance of wood, but it is more stable than wood, has no scars, does not deform easily, and can present a variety of colors. From the perspective of processing technology, the wood-plastic floor can be processed twice to meet the profile specification standards, and its installation is more convenient.
